The Why

The answer is "Pass slower traffic by briefly crossing into the oncoming lane when the way is clear"

A single broken yellow center line permits passing when the way is clear. A driver may briefly cross into the oncoming lane to pass slower traffic and then return. The trap is the answer that treats this line as a two-way left-turn lane; those lanes are marked with outer solid yellow lines paired with inner broken yellow lines, and a driver who learned that pattern first can reach for it here.

Why the others miss

The traps in the wrong answers

B. Make left turns from the center lane in either direction of travel

A two-way left-turn lane uses outer solid yellow with inner broken yellow, not a lone broken center line. This answer grabs the compound arrangement that identifies a shared turning corridor as if it applied here.

C. Drive in the oncoming lane whenever traffic in the driver's own lane is heavy

The marking permits passing only when the way is clear, not whenever traffic in the driver's own lane feels heavy. This answer reads a safety condition as a convenience allowance the driver may claim in congestion.

D. Straddle the line to share the roadway with wide oncoming vehicles

The line separates opposing traffic and does not authorize straddling or sharing the center. This answer treats a divider as shared pavement whenever an oncoming vehicle looks wide.
